Definitions and Classifications of Water Supply Data

The definitions and classifications of water supply data are fundamental for establishing clear legal understanding and compliance standards within the Water Supply Law. They specify the nature and types of data that must be collected, stored, and analyzed under the legal framework.

Water supply data can be broadly categorized into several types, including technical, operational, and environmental data. Examples include flow rates, water quality parameters, and consumption metrics, all of which are essential for regulatory oversight.

Key classifications include static versus dynamic data. Static data refers to unchanging information, such as infrastructure details, while dynamic data involves real-time information, like water pressure or contamination levels. This distinction informs the legal requirements for data collection protocols.

Legal regulations typically define specific data categories, ensuring consistent compliance. These classifications guide water authorities and operators in understanding their legal obligations to accurately record, report, and safeguard water supply data in accordance with applicable statutes.

Data Collection Standards and Protocols

Standards and protocols for water supply data collection establish a consistent framework ensuring accuracy, reliability, and legal compliance. These guidelines specify the methods and procedures that data collectors must follow to maintain data integrity and transparency.

Typically, regulations mandate the use of calibrated instruments and validated measurement techniques. Data collection should be conducted systematically, often involving regular calibration and quality checks to prevent inaccuracies. Additionally, documentation practices, such as records of collection times, locations, and personnel involved, are emphasized.

Compliance with established protocols involves adherence to specific operational steps, reporting formats, and the use of approved technologies. This standardization facilitates data comparability across different jurisdictions and aligns with legal requirements. Enforcement agencies may perform audits to verify protocol adherence, ensuring the legal integrity of water supply data collection.

Fines and Sanctions

Fines and sanctions serve as critical enforcement tools within the legal regulations on water supply data collection. They aim to deter violations of water supply laws and ensure compliance with established standards. Under the Water Supply Law, non-compliance with data collection protocols can result in significant penalties. These may include monetary fines, administrative sanctions, or restrictions on water supply operations, depending on the severity of the violation.

Legal frameworks typically specify graduated penalties that escalate with repeated or deliberate breaches. For example, failing to obtain proper permits or tampering with water data records can lead to fines ranging from modest penalties to substantial financial sanctions. Such measures underscore the importance of adhering to data collection standards and protocols.

International and Comparative Legal Standards

International and comparative legal standards influence water supply data collection by establishing common principles and best practices that transcend national boundaries. These standards promote consistency, accuracy, and transparency in data gathering processes across different jurisdictions.

Organizations such as the United Nations and the World Health Organization have issued guidelines emphasizing the importance of data integrity, security, and privacy in water management. These frameworks often serve as benchmarks for countries seeking to align their water supply laws with global best practices.

Comparative analyses reveal significant variations in how nations regulate water supply data collection. For example, some countries implement strict data privacy laws modeled after the GDPR in Europe, while others focus more on data accessibility and sharing protocols. Understanding these differences helps stakeholders navigate international compliance requirements.

Aligning local regulations with international standards enhances regulatory compatibility and supports cross-border water initiatives. It also encourages harmonization of legal provisions related to water data collection, fostering global cooperation and sustainable water management practices worldwide.
